Searched refs:dma_addr_t (Results 276 - 300 of 2568) sorted by relevance

<<11121314151617181920>>

/linux-master/drivers/infiniband/hw/erdma/
H A Derdma_verbs.h100 dma_addr_t buf_dma;
143 dma_addr_t sq_db_info_dma_addr;
144 dma_addr_t rq_db_info_dma_addr;
165 dma_addr_t sq_buf_dma_addr;
168 dma_addr_t rq_buf_dma_addr;
242 dma_addr_t qbuf_dma_addr;
255 dma_addr_t db_info_dma_addr;
/linux-master/drivers/net/ethernet/broadcom/
H A Dcnic.h126 dma_addr_t mapping;
134 dma_addr_t *pg_map_arr;
137 dma_addr_t pgtbl_map;
163 dma_addr_t kwqe_data_mapping;
198 dma_addr_t l2_ring_map;
202 dma_addr_t l2_buf_map;
263 dma_addr_t status_blk_map;
/linux-master/include/linux/
H A Ddmaengine.h151 dma_addr_t src_start;
152 dma_addr_t dst_start;
562 dma_addr_t addr[];
603 dma_addr_t phys;
888 struct dma_chan *chan, dma_addr_t dst, dma_addr_t src,
891 struct dma_chan *chan, dma_addr_t dst, dma_addr_t *src,
894 struct dma_chan *chan, dma_addr_t *src, unsigned int src_cnt,
897 struct dma_chan *chan, dma_addr_t *ds
[all...]
H A Dhisi_acc_qm.h217 dma_addr_t dma;
320 dma_addr_t sqc_dma;
321 dma_addr_t cqc_dma;
322 dma_addr_t eqc_dma;
323 dma_addr_t aeqc_dma;
355 dma_addr_t sqc_dma;
356 dma_addr_t cqc_dma;
357 dma_addr_t eqe_dma;
358 dma_addr_t aeqe_dma;
423 dma_addr_t sqe_dm
[all...]
/linux-master/drivers/accel/ivpu/
H A Divpu_mmu_context.c45 static void *ivpu_pgtable_alloc_page(struct ivpu_device *vdev, dma_addr_t *dma)
47 dma_addr_t dma_addr;
77 static void ivpu_pgtable_free_page(struct ivpu_device *vdev, u64 *cpu_addr, dma_addr_t dma_addr)
93 dma_addr_t pgd_dma;
107 dma_addr_t pud_dma, pmd_dma, pte_dma;
147 dma_addr_t pud_dma;
184 dma_addr_t pmd_dma;
213 dma_addr_t pte_dma;
230 u64 vpu_addr, dma_addr_t dma_addr, u64 prot)
259 dma_addr_t dma_add
[all...]
/linux-master/sound/soc/samsung/
H A Didma.c41 dma_addr_t start;
42 dma_addr_t pos;
43 dma_addr_t end;
44 dma_addr_t period;
45 dma_addr_t periodsz;
53 dma_addr_t lp_tx_addr;
58 static void idma_getpos(dma_addr_t *src)
228 dma_addr_t src;
385 void idma_reg_addr_init(void __iomem *regs, dma_addr_t addr)
/linux-master/drivers/scsi/
H A Dmvumi.h27 #define IS_DMA64 (sizeof(dma_addr_t) == 8)
213 dma_addr_t bus_addr;
249 dma_addr_t frame_phys;
496 dma_addr_t ib_list_phys;
499 dma_addr_t ib_frame_phys;
502 dma_addr_t ob_list_phys;
505 dma_addr_t ib_shadow_phys;
508 dma_addr_t ob_shadow_phys;
511 dma_addr_t handshake_page_phys;
H A Dwd719x.h58 dma_addr_t phys; /* bus address of the SCB */
59 dma_addr_t dma_handle;
71 dma_addr_t fw_phys; /* firmware buffer bus address */
74 dma_addr_t params_phys; /* host parameters bus address */
76 dma_addr_t hash_phys; /* hash table bus address */
/linux-master/drivers/net/ethernet/qualcomm/emac/
H A Demac-mac.h135 dma_addr_t dma_addr; /* dma address */
146 dma_addr_t dma_addr; /* dma address */
153 dma_addr_t dma_addr; /* dma address */
164 dma_addr_t dma_addr; /* physical address */
197 dma_addr_t dma_addr; /* dma address */
/linux-master/sound/pci/trident/
H A Dtrident_memory.c25 (dma_addr_t)le32_to_cpu((trident->tlb.entries[page]) & ~(SNDRV_TRIDENT_PAGE_SIZE - 1))
52 dma_addr_t addr)
81 dma_addr_t addr)
186 dma_addr_t addr = snd_pcm_sgbuf_get_addr(substream, ofs);
209 dma_addr_t addr;
/linux-master/drivers/media/platform/ti/vpe/
H A Dvpdma.h20 dma_addr_t dma_addr;
226 struct vpdma_desc_list *list, dma_addr_t dma_addr,
245 const struct vpdma_data_format *fmt, dma_addr_t dma_addr,
249 const struct vpdma_data_format *fmt, dma_addr_t dma_addr,
254 const struct vpdma_data_format *fmt, dma_addr_t dma_addr,
/linux-master/drivers/net/ethernet/netronome/nfp/
H A Dnfp_net_dp.h9 static inline dma_addr_t nfp_net_dma_map_rx(struct nfp_net_dp *dp, void *frag)
17 nfp_net_dma_sync_dev_rx(const struct nfp_net_dp *dp, dma_addr_t dma_addr)
25 dma_addr_t dma_addr)
33 dma_addr_t dma_addr,
103 void *nfp_net_rx_alloc_one(struct nfp_net_dp *dp, dma_addr_t *dma_addr);
/linux-master/arch/powerpc/kernel/
H A Ddma-iommu.c27 bool arch_dma_unmap_page_direct(struct device *dev, dma_addr_t dma_handle)
79 dma_addr_t *dma_handle, gfp_t flag,
88 void *vaddr, dma_addr_t dma_handle,
96 * comprises a page address and offset into that page. The dma_addr_t
99 static dma_addr_t dma_iommu_map_page(struct device *dev, struct page *page,
109 static void dma_iommu_unmap_page(struct device *dev, dma_addr_t dma_handle,
/linux-master/drivers/net/ethernet/engleder/
H A Dtsnep.h65 dma_addr_t desc_dma;
86 dma_addr_t page_dma[TSNEP_RING_PAGE_COUNT];
103 dma_addr_t desc_dma;
112 dma_addr_t dma;
122 dma_addr_t page_dma[TSNEP_RING_PAGE_COUNT];
/linux-master/drivers/scsi/qla2xxx/
H A Dqla_gbl.h338 qla2x00_load_ram(scsi_qla_host_t *, dma_addr_t, uint32_t, uint32_t);
341 qla2x00_dump_ram(scsi_qla_host_t *, dma_addr_t, uint32_t, uint32_t);
362 qla2x00_issue_iocb(scsi_qla_host_t *, void *, dma_addr_t, size_t);
402 qla2x00_send_sns(scsi_qla_host_t *, dma_addr_t, uint16_t, size_t);
425 qla2x00_get_id_list(scsi_qla_host_t *, void *, dma_addr_t, uint16_t *);
436 dma_addr_t);
440 dma_addr_t, uint16_t);
471 qla2x00_enable_eft_trace(scsi_qla_host_t *, dma_addr_t, uint16_t);
476 qla2x00_enable_fce_trace(scsi_qla_host_t *, dma_addr_t, uint16_t , uint16_t *,
493 dma_addr_t);
[all...]
/linux-master/drivers/iommu/
H A Drockchip-iommu.c85 dma_addr_t dt_dma;
99 u32 (*mk_dtentries)(dma_addr_t pt_dma);
127 static inline void rk_table_flush(struct rk_iommu_domain *dom, dma_addr_t dma,
221 static inline u32 rk_mk_dte(dma_addr_t pt_dma)
226 static inline u32 rk_mk_dte_v2(dma_addr_t pt_dma)
319 static u32 rk_iova_dte_index(dma_addr_t iova)
324 static u32 rk_iova_pte_index(dma_addr_t iova)
329 static u32 rk_iova_page_offset(dma_addr_t iova)
356 static void rk_iommu_zap_lines(struct rk_iommu *iommu, dma_addr_t iova_start,
360 dma_addr_t iova_en
[all...]
/linux-master/drivers/net/ethernet/broadcom/bnx2x/
H A Dbnx2x_sp.h85 dma_addr_t rdata_mapping;
489 dma_addr_t rdata_mapping;
922 dma_addr_t sge_map;
963 dma_addr_t dscr_map;
964 dma_addr_t sge_map;
965 dma_addr_t rcq_map;
966 dma_addr_t rcq_np_map;
994 dma_addr_t dscr_map;
1079 dma_addr_t rdata_mapping;
1341 dma_addr_t rdata_mappin
[all...]
/linux-master/drivers/scsi/mpi3mr/
H A Dmpi3mr.h250 dma_addr_t kern_buf_dma;
374 dma_addr_t segment_dma;
403 dma_addr_t q_segment_list_dma;
431 dma_addr_t q_segment_list_dma;
863 dma_addr_t dma_addr;
876 dma_addr_t dma_addr;
1084 dma_addr_t admin_req_dma;
1092 dma_addr_t admin_reply_dma;
1116 dma_addr_t reply_buf_dma;
1117 dma_addr_t reply_buf_dma_max_addres
[all...]
/linux-master/drivers/scsi/megaraid/
H A Dmegaraid_ioctl.h139 dma_addr_t pthru32_h;
145 dma_addr_t buf_paddr;
239 dma_addr_t paddr;
/linux-master/drivers/media/pci/tw686x/
H A Dtw686x.h43 dma_addr_t phys;
55 dma_addr_t dma;
71 dma_addr_t ptr;
/linux-master/drivers/media/platform/st/stm32/dma2d/
H A Ddma2d-hw.c62 dma_addr_t o_addr)
88 dma_addr_t f_addr)
112 dma_addr_t b_addr)
/linux-master/drivers/net/ethernet/hisilicon/hns3/
H A Dhns3_trace.h75 __field(dma_addr_t, desc_dma)
106 __field(dma_addr_t, desc_dma)
107 __field(dma_addr_t, buf_dma)
/linux-master/drivers/scsi/fnic/
H A Dvnic_dev.h80 dma_addr_t bus_addr;
87 dma_addr_t base_addr;
91 dma_addr_t base_addr_unaligned;
/linux-master/drivers/message/fusion/
H A Dmptbase.h486 dma_addr_t IocPg4_dma; /* Phys Addr of IOCPage4 data */
538 dma_addr_t dma;
594 typedef void (*MPT_ADD_SGE)(void *pAddr, u32 flagslength, dma_addr_t dma_addr);
596 dma_addr_t dma_addr);
633 dma_addr_t alloc_dma;
653 dma_addr_t ChainBufferDMA;
657 dma_addr_t req_frames_dma;
669 dma_addr_t sense_buf_pool_dma;
673 dma_addr_t HostPageBuffer_dma;
691 dma_addr_t cached_fw_dm
[all...]
/linux-master/drivers/net/ethernet/qlogic/qed/
H A Dqed_dev_api.h267 u32 grc_addr, dma_addr_t dest_addr, u32 size_in_dwords,
286 dma_addr_t source_addr,
287 dma_addr_t dest_addr,

Completed in 222 milliseconds

<<11121314151617181920>>